Specification of LM358WDT | |
---|---|
Status | Obsolete |
Package | Tape & Reel (TR),Cut Tape (CT),Digi-Reel? |
Supplier | Rohm Semiconductor |
Amplifier Type | General Purpose |
Number of Circuits | 2 |
Output Type | – |
Slew Rate | 0.3V/s |
Gain Bandwidth Product | 1.1 MHz |
-3db Bandwidth | – |
Current – Input Bias | 20 nA |
Voltage – Input Offset | 1 mV |
Current – Supply | 600A |
Current – Output / Channel | 40 mA |
Voltage – Supply Span (Min) | 3 V |
Voltage – Supply Span (Max) | 32 V |
Operating Temperature | -40C ~ 85C |
Mounting Type | Surface Mount |
Package / Case | 8-SOIC (0.154″, 3.90mm Width) |
Supplier Device Package | 8-SOP-J |
